Quoting: arafay
I believe that the jets can choose between 1 and 2 years in arbitration if I am not wrong. Correct me if so


Whomever opts for arbitration, the opposite party chooses term of either 1 or 2 years with exception of the final year of RFA which must be 1 year. Arbitration awards can only cover RFA years.
